She also says "Blue Ruin" is a nettle -- Viper's Bugloss is not technically a nettle, but the term was used for similar plants with bristly hairs, which Viper's Bugloss is. She has her Blue Ruin growing on once-disturbed soil with daisies, which is also typical of Viper's Bugloss.

Blue Ruin was a common slang term for gin, the alcoholic drink. (less)
